As if Michelle Obama hadn't already cemented herself as the most fashion-forward (potential or actual) First Lady in nearly half a century, last night she chose to wear a dress from young NYC deisgner Thakoon Panichgul's pre-spring 2009 collection. The floral Radzimir kimono dress, accessorized with a trio of Erickson Beamon broaches at the neckline, was an unconventional choice, as FWD notes "political women often sport the likes of Oscar de la Renta and Carolina Herrera." The masses will become even more aware of Thakoon come December when he launches a collection for Target. All the Rage points you to a floral frock currently available from the designer, which runs $1,250.
